Put 2017-06-14 · The place step sequence operates in a similar fashion but is only started when a part is present in the gripper, and the pick sequence is not in cycle. In any step sequence, it is important to include steps at the beginning and perhaps the end of the cycle to home the machine and tooling before work is performed, and part tracking bits are set and reset.

Where the work happens is in the automatic step sequence. For example, a pick and place (P&P) machine may have two automatic cycles, a pick sequence and a place sequence. Programming a Sequencer in Ladder Logic on a PLC is an advanced skill. It’s a technique which utilizes SQI and SQO instructions in order to create a sequence of events which is based on specific steps & allows the PLC to follow a prescribed sequence of events.
